Greetings Family and Friends!
As most of you may or may not know I dropped out of college in 1988 to start a business and at that time I was more interested in working than going to school. I was blessed with steady growth which evolved my company into two successful businesses since 1988. In 2000, I decided to go back to school to finish my undergraduate degree and on August 13th, 2004, I graduated from Texas A&M University. These 4 years have been a challenge with working over 65 hrs a week while taking classes whenever possible.

As if this was not amazing enough, I decided to keep my degree quest a secret from my Mom and Dad and everyone outside Texas so that I could keep the secret safe until the great event. On August 12th, 2004 I had my parents flown out to Texas under false pretenses. They were told that I was to win an award and that they were being flown out to surprise me when they arrived.

Needless to say, when they realized the surprise was actually for them it was an incredibly emotional experience.  My Texas family held a party with over 100 friends and faculty the following day. There is just nothing better in this world than family..

I have updated this web site with information, pictures, and video clips from this event. The local TV station was at the commencement ceremony and interviewed my parents and me for the 10’oclock news.

Some of you already know this and others were in the dark for the sake of the surprise.  I am now happy to be able to share this with you.. AND most importantly I thank you for being there for me to make this "mission possible".
